FOOD CONTACT
The ‘food contact’ designation is a certification that guarantees the safety of materials and articles (including single-use gloves) intended to come into contact with food.
To be suitable for food contact, a disposable glove must comply with three different regulations:

THE 3 MANDATORY REGULATIONS
Règlement Européen (UE) N° 1935/2004
The general requirements set out the principles of inertness and harmlessness.
The single-use glove must not be liable to:
Pose a risk to human health.
To alter the composition of foodstuffs in an unacceptable manner.
To alter the organoleptic characteristics of foodstuffs (taste, appearance, colour, texture).
Sets out the requirements for labelling, the declaration of conformity and traceability.
Règlement (CE) N° 2023/2006
The Commission of 22 December 2006 sets out Good Manufacturing Practices, stating:
Quality assurance system.
Quality control system.
Documentation demonstrating product compliance and safety.
Type de matériaux
Depending on the type of materials:
Plastic (vinyl, PE and TPE gloves): Regulation (EU) No 10/2011 applies Rubber (nitrile and latex gloves): National regulations apply (NEW French decree of 5 August 2020)
The following must be stated:
The positive list of ingredients
General migration tests (stability) and specific migration tests (hazardous substances)
Additional tests in accordance with Regulation (EC) No 1935/2004 (organoleptic tests and migration of restricted substances)
The food contact symbol clearly visible on packaging:

The “glass and fork” symbol on the packaging indicates that the material is suitable for food contact and has successfully passed the relevant tests.
